Subject: [PATCH 6/6] spi/s3c64xx: Allow usage for ARCH_S3C24XX
Date: Sun, 4 Mar 2012 19:09:10 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<201203041909.10400.heiko@sntech.de>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<201203041902.38318.heiko@sntech.de>

Newer SoCs from the S3C24XX line, namely S3C2416/2443/2450 contain
hsspi-controllers compatible with the s3c64xx type.

The previous patches enabled platform support for it, so make the
driver also usable for the S3C24xx architecture.

Signed-off-by: Heiko Stuebner <heiko@sntech.de>
---
As it is part of a series this probably needs an ack from Grant Likely
and should be merged via the samsung tree.

 drivers/spi/Kconfig |    2 +-
 1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/spi/Kconfig b/drivers/spi/Kconfig
index ac92194..e411364 100644
--- a/drivers/spi/Kconfig
+++ b/drivers/spi/Kconfig
@@ -299,7 +299,7 @@ config SPI_S3C24XX_FIQ
 
 config SPI_S3C64XX
 	tristate "Samsung S3C64XX series type SPI"
-	depends on (ARCH_S3C64XX || ARCH_S5P64X0 || ARCH_EXYNOS)
+	depends on (ARCH_S3C24XX || ARCH_S3C64XX || ARCH_S5P64X0 || ARCH_EXYNOS)
 	select S3C64XX_DMA if ARCH_S3C64XX
 	help
 	  SPI driver for Samsung S3C64XX and newer SoCs.
